Stop sign approved at Page Road intersection after staff cites speeding

Harrison County Commissioners Court · August 15, 2026

Summary

After a public hearing with no opposition, commissioners approved a stop sign at the Page Road/North Page Road intersection in Precinct 3 and discussed adding a brake bar and center stripe to calm traffic after road improvements.

Road staff recommended placing a stop sign at the intersection of Page Road (County Road 3542) and North Page Road (County Road 3531) in Precinct 3, saying that with the newly improved surface "traffic is really speeding up and picking up in that area." The court opened a public hearing and recorded no public opposition before taking action.

The court approved the stop sign placement order as read; staff also said they will pursue installing a brake bar and a center stripe down the middle of the roadway to further improve safety. The motion carried by voice vote (4–0).
